公司环境,因为要连本地 ip ,今天发现突然无法访问内网了,ping 不通对应 ip ,浏览器也打不开对应页面, 一开始以为是我代理软件的问题,前端时间刚从 cfw 切换到 verge ,结果换回 cfw 发现还不行,关掉代理也不行。 然后又想是不是系统原因,因为前几天刚升级到 Sequoia 。但是同组的同事跟我同系统也没问题。
这时候想起同事用的是内置终端我用的是 iTerm ,于是我换了终端发现居然能 ping 通了,接着我把打不开的网页放到 safari 中居然也能打开了,感到不可思议,难不成软件出问题了,不可能啊!
最后发现是设置中隐私与安全中的本地网络中 iTerm 和 Chrome 的权限没打开
“允许应用程序查找本地网络中的设置并与之通信”,我一直以为只是用来查找像打印机、电视这种设备并连接的功能,没想到还能控制软件内网的访问
1
ab 23 天前 via iPhone
我遇到类似问题,sing-box 不能直连内网或者本地虚拟机。 之前也怀疑过这个原因,但是 sing-box 不在允许应用程序查找本地网络中的设置并与之通信的列表,也无法添加
|
2
abcl8023y 23 天前 1
如果升级到 MacOS Sequoia 网络有问题,检查这三项:
1. 系统设置-隐私和安全-本地网络,将存在网络问题软件的开关打开; 2. 系统设置-网络-过滤条件,尝试关闭一些防火墙服务,比如 Little Snitch ; 3. 系统设置-网络-防火墙,将其关闭。 |
3
echen 23 天前
Wi-Fi 网络设置里把私有 Wi-Fi 地址关了
|